Discussion Board Initial Post – Brian Schaeffner
Theology first affects our identity and choices in real life. Our beliefs about God have a direct impact on how we live. If we believe that God is in charge and will take care of us, we can deal with uncertainty with confidence instead of fear. When we understand doctrines like creation and the imago Dei, we remember that everyone has value and dignity. This changes how we treat people at work, at home, and in our communities. Theology is not abstract; it delineates our identity and our interaction with the world. Second, theology connects by showing us how to deal with pain and problems. A biblical theology of the cross and resurrection instructs us that suffering is not futile but can be utilized by God for His glory and our benefit (Rom. 8:28). This point of view gives people real hope when things are hard. Theology provides believers with endurance, comfort, and the assurance that Christ accompanies them in every season.
